Parachute uses #MyParachuteHome to retarget ads
Parachute uses visual content and social media to drive foot traffic inside stores. While most of the retargeting advertisements are digital, Parachute is heavily reliant on visual content and social media. By leveraging social media and visual content in their marketing campaigns, they hope to create an experience that melds different messages. The company plans to open five retail locations in San Francisco within the next few months.

The brand enlisted its users to use the hashtag #MyParachuteHome on their social media posts when featuring their products. Parachute's promotional content saw a 35% rise in CTR and a 66% reduction in CPC by repurposing photos from customers. This content can be relatable and gives the audience a voice.

Is content marketing easy to measure?
Yes! It's part of the process. It helps you determine whether your efforts were successful and whether you need to make changes.
It is possible to track the number of visitors from different sources, including organic search, email and social media. You can also track conversions such as sales leads or purchases.
These metrics can tell you which pieces of content performed well and where your most significant opportunities lie.
